Librería de componentes Web de Claro
- Instalar librería
Instalar el paquete en los los micro frontend donde se van a utilizar
npm i claro-ui
- En el archivo
webpack.config.js
agregar la siguiente configuración en elreturn
return merge(defaultConfig, {
module: {
rules: [
{
test: /\.m?js/,
resolve: {
fullySpecified: false,
},
},
],
},
});
- Importar la librería en
/src/(nombreproyecto).jsx/tsx
import "claro-ui"
- En el archivo
app.component.ts
agregarCUSTOM_ELEMENTS_SCHEMA
a la configuracion de schemas del modulo o componente raiz
import { CUSTOM_ELEMENTS_SCHEMA } from '@angular/core';
@Component({
schemas: [CUSTOM_ELEMENTS_SCHEMA]
})
export class AppComponent {
.
.
.
}
- Importar la librería en
app.component.ts
import "claro-ui"